Spectral stability of Prandtl boundary layers: an overview
Emmanuel Grenier, Yan Guo, Toan T. Nguyen
Published 2014-06-17Version 1
In this paper we show how the stability of Prandtl boundary layers is linked to the stability of shear flows in the incompressible Navier Stokes equations. We then recall classical physical instability results, and give a short educational presentation of the construction of unstable modes for Orr Sommerfeld equations. We end the paper with a conjecture concerning the validity of Prandtl boundary layer asymptotic expansions.
